Police are investigating an incident which took place on the M11 during which a man sustained injuries to his arm

The incident happened shortly before 8am on Tuesday 26 April and involved the driver of a grey Nissan and the driver of a black BMW. 
The two men were involved in an argument on the hard shoulder of the northbound  M11, close to Chigwell, when the driver of the Nissan was assaulted.
He sustained injuries which required hospital treatment, but which are not considered to be life-threatening or life-changing.
As a result of our initial enquiries, a 44-year-old man was arrested on suspicion of GBH and criminal damage. He has been released under investigation. 
Police  enquiries are continuing, and we need anyone who witnessed the incident or has any dashcam footage of it to get in touch.
